<p><strong>The Exhibition</strong></p>
<p><strong><span style="font-weight:normal;">Ancestral Power and the Aesthetic is the first exhibition to give focus to the extraordinary painted works collected from Arnhem Land by the University of Melbourne anthropologist, the late Professor Donald Thomson (1901-1970). The works in the exhibition comprise 20 extraordinary bark paintings and 16 objects including painted baskets and other men’s ceremonial objects as well as artists’ tools and pigments. </span></strong></p>
<p>Curator: Ms Lindy Allen</p>

<p><strong>The Pitch</strong><br />
We would like to offer this exhibition to regional Victorian venues.</p>
<p>Given the high value of the works in the vicinity of $5.5m and size and nature of the works, a risk assessment will be required that includes an assessment of venues and whether they meet the highest international standards for exhibition, security and handling required. This includes identifying requirements for conservation and other MV staff to install and/or pack up the exhibition at particular venues, and with this, opportunities for MV to contribute to the skills development of staff in regional venues in Victoria particularly may be identified.</p>
